I'll try to explain it simply.
If you have 150 steem power and power it down you get 150 steem.
If steem is worth $2 each when you start powering down and worth $1 each when you finish powering down, it's irrelevant, you powered down 150 steem. Prices change, that's all crypto and currencies in general. Just because you start a power down when steem is worth $2 each doesn't mean the rest of the world won't continue to change the value of steem while you are powering down. We all continue to do our transactions and you still have your same amount of steem. If steem had become more valuable while you powered down your total would have increased. It's a simple supply and demand economy.
